MISSOULA, Mont. - The Missoula Metropolitan Planning Organization is entering its final phase of getting feedback before it begins making major improvements to Highway 200. The East Missoula-Highway 200 Corridor Plan comes in response to multiple pedestrian deaths over the last ten years and other safety concerns. The project will run from Van Buren Street, through East Missoula, to Tamarack Road near Bonner. According to Aaron Wilson, infrastructure and mobility planning manager for the city of Missoula, the big highlights of the plan are to add more sidewalks and crosswalks along the road, connect bike trails from East Missoula to Bonner and add more street lights.Â
